  • Central Guarantee Fund — A fund set aside by state insurance regulators to pay out claims to policyholders in the event an insurance company becomes insolvent. The central guarantee funds are accumulated from regular assessments charged to operating insurance companies.… …   Investment dictionary

  • contract guarantee insurance — An insurance policy designed to guarantee the financial solvency of a contractor during the performance of a contract. If the contractor becomes financially insolvent and cannot complete the work the insurer makes a payment equivalent to the… …   Big dictionary of business and management
